Kyra Gracie (born 1985), daughter of Flavia Gracie. Kyra is a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u black belt. Her uncles are Ralph Gracie, Renzo Gracie, and Ryan Gracie. She is one of the few Gracie women to hold that rank and is the first Gracie female to actively compete in the sport. Her competition titles include: 5 Time Brazilian Champion (98,99,00,01,04); 5 Time State Champion (98,99,00,01,02); World Champion (2004); ADCC Champion (2005); 4 Time Pan American Champion (01,02,03,05).
